Specifications
Series: XJ
Packaging: Tape & Reel (TR) 
Part Status: Active
Type: MHz Crystal
Frequency: 25MHz
Frequency Stability: ±15ppm
Frequency Tolerance: ±15ppm
Load Capacitance: 18pF
ESR (Equivalent Series Resistance): 25 Ohms
Operating Mode: Fundamental
Operating Temperature: -20°C ~ 70°C
Ratings: --
Mounting Type: Surface Mount
Package / Case: HC-49/US
Size / Dimension: 0.449" L x 0.177" W (11.40mm x 4.50mm)
Height - Seated (Max): 0.165" (4.20mm)
